Child porn suspects appear in court

2 June 2004

AMSTERDAM — A lawyer for the public prosecutor urged Arnhem Court on Wednesday to impose an eight-year jail term and TBS detention with compulsory psychiatric treatment on two men charged with being members of a child pornography network.
 
The 35-year-old C. V. and the 32-year-old R. J. are accused of being involved in a group that organised sex holidays, produced and spread child pornography and sexually abused male youths.

Sexual acts were also allegedly performed via an internet web camera and telephone, news agency ANP reported.

V. is accused of acting as a guide for sex trips to Tunisia and the prosecution alleges that men picked out boys out of slum areas and paid them for sex. The prosecution said it was pure child prostitution.

Both men, of Arnhem, have largely confessed to the charges and are also accused of raping two 14-year-old boys. The victims had run away from a boarding school in the central Dutch town of Hoenderloo.

In total, seven suspects were due to appear before Arnhem Court on Wednesday. Police raided 18 locations at the end of 2003 and seized 2,000 discs, 3,500 photos and 3,200 videos. Justice authorities expect to carry out more arrests.
